top of page
VR Goggles

CyberSecurity

School of Computing

Advantages & Careers

With the Smart Cities & Smart Systems tremendous growth and potentials, the need for experts in cyber security to build safeguards needed to protect citizens from cyber thefts and attacks is enormous.

 

Cyber Security is one of the most in-demand fields in the world.

Future Careers:

  • Computer Scientist

  • Chief Information Security Officer/Engineer.

  • Forensic Computer Analyst.

  • Information Security Analyst.

  • Penetration Tester and evaluator.

  • Security Architect.

  • Cyber Security Engineer.

  • Security Systems Administrator.

  • IT Security Consultant.

Program Summary

CyberSecurity programs prepare students for careers in the network security industry including computer forensics, ethical hacking, applied offensive and defensive security, and human and organizational security. Students will learn about evolving threats and the proper use of specific security tools.

 

Both security theories and hands-on practice are emphasized in this program.

Program Objectives

1. Produce graduates that are enthusiastic and knowledgeable about the rapidly changing discipline of cyber security and networks, and appreciate its growing impact on modern living.

​

2. Produce graduates that will uphold the legal, ethical and professional standards expected of a cyber security and networks specialist.

3. Enable students to acquire a range of practical, professional and transferable skills to equip them to contribute to their chosen profession in cyber security or computer networks, or to pursue further study.

​

4. Enable students to engage with current research issues to consolidate their knowledge base and understanding of currently available technologies and emerging trends in cyber security and computer networks.

5. Develop students’ cognitive and critical reflection skills to equip them for enterprise, employment and further academic research.

​

6. Provide an industry and commercially relevant cyber security and computer networks education for students from a variety of subject backgrounds and/or employment experience utilising appropriate modes of study.

Year 1 - UK Level 3
   2 Core Mandatory Subjects
+ 3 Optional Subjects
+    General Education Subjects

YEAR 1 - UK Level 3

​

 2 Core Mandatory Subjects/Units

  1. Unit 1: CMP101 Information Technology Systems – Strategy, Management and Infrastructure (120 GLH)

  2. Unit 6: CMP106 Website Development (60 GLH)

​

3 Optional Subjects/Units

to choose from the following list:

​

  1. Unit 2: CMP102 Creating Systems to Manage Information (90 GLH)

  2. Unit 3: CMP103 Using Social Media in Business (90 GLH) 

  3. Unit 4:CMP104 Programming (90 GLH)

  4. Unit 5:CMP105 Data Modelling (60 GLH)

  5. Unit 7:CMP107 Mobile Apps Development (60 GLH)

  6. Unit 8:CMP108 Computer Games Development (60 GLH)

  7. Unit 9:CMP109 IT Project Management (60 GLH)

  8. Unit 10:CMP110 Big Data and Business Analytics (60 GLH)

  9. Unit 12:CMP112 IT Technical Support and Management (60 GLH)

  10. Unit 13:CMP113 Software Testing (60 GLH)

  11. Unit 14:CMP114 Customising and Integrating Applications (60 GLH)

  12. Unit 15:CMP115 Cloud Storage and Collaboration Tools (60 GLH)

  13. Unit 16:CMP116 Digital 2D and 3D Graphics (60 GLH)

  14. Unit 17:CMP117 Digital Animation and Effects (60 GLH)

  15. Unit 18:CMP118 The Internet of Things (60 GLH)

  16. Unit 19:CMP119 Enterprise in IT (60 GLH)

  17. Unit 20:CMP120 Business Process Modelling Tools (60 GLH)

  18. Unit 21:CMP121 Introduction to Artificial Intelligence (AI) (60 GLH)

  19. Unit 22:CMP122 Introduction to Robotics and Automation (60 GLH)

  20. Unit 23:CMP123 Emerging Trends and Technologies (60 GLH)

  21. Unit 24:CMP124 Technical Fundamentals for Computing Professionals (60 GLH)

  22. Unit 25:CMP125 Full Stack Development (60 GLH)

​

+ General Education Subjects

Year 2 - UK Level 4
   6 Core Mandatory Subjects
+ 1 Mandatory Specialist Subject
+
1 Optional Subject
+   General Education Subjects

YEAR 2 - UK Level 4

​

Core Mandatory Subjects/Units

  1. Unit 1: CMP201 Programming (15 UK Credits)

  2. Unit 2: CMP202 Networking (15 UK Credits)

  3. Unit 3: CMP203 Professional Practice (15 UK Credits)

  4. Unit 4: CMP204 Database Design & Development (15 UK Credits)

  5. Unit 5: CMP205 Security (15 UK Credits)

  6. Unit 6: CMP206 Planning a Computing Project (15 UK Credits) 

 

+ 1 Mandatory Specialist Subject/Unit

  1. Unit 10: CMP210 Cybersecurity (15 UK Credits)

​

+ 1 Optional Subject/Unit

to choose from the following list:

  1. Unit 11: CMP211 Strategic Information Systems (15 UK Credits)

  2. Unit 12: CMP212 Management in the Digital Economy (15 UK Credits)

  3. Unit 13: CMP213 Website Design & Development (15 UK Credits)

  4. Unit 14: CMP214 Maths for Computing (15 UK Credits)

  5. Unit 15: CMP215 Fundamentals of Artificial Intelligence (AI) & Intelligent Systems (15 UK Credits)

​

+ General Education Subjects

Year 3 - UK Level 5
   2 Core Mandatory Subjects
+ 3 Mandatory Specialist Subjects
+
2 Optional Subjects
+   General Education Subjects

YEAR 3 - UK Level 5

​

Core Mandatory Subjects/Units

  1. Unit 16: CMP316 Computing Research Project (30 UK Credits)

  2. Unit 17: CMP317 Business Process Support (15 UK Credits)

 

+ 3 Mandatory Specialist Subjects/Units

  1. Unit 30: CMP330 Applied Cryptography in the Cloud (15 UK Credits)

  2. Unit 31: CMP331 Forensics (15 UK Credits)

  3. Unit 32: CMP332 Information Security Management (15 UK Credits)

​

+ 2 Optional Subjects/Units

to choose from the following list:

  1. Unit 18: CMP318 Discrete Maths (15 UK Credits)

  2. Unit 19: CMP319 Data Structures & Algorithms (15 UK Credits)

  3. Unit 20: CMP320 Applied Programming and Design Principle (15 UK Credits)

  4. Unit 24: CMP324 Advanced Programming for Data Analysis (15 UK Credits)

  5. Unit 25: CMP325 Machine Learning (15 UK Credits)

  6. Unit 26: CMP326 Big Data Analytics and Visualisation (15 UK Credits)

  7. Unit 33: CMP333 Applied Analytical Models (15 UK Credits)

  8. Unit 34: CMP334 Analytical Methods (15 UK Credits)

  9. Unit 35: CMP335 Systems Analysis & Design (15 UK Credits)

  10. Unit 36 CMP336 User Experience & Interface Design (15 UK Credits)

  11. Unit 37: CMP337 Architecture (15 UK Credits)

  12. Unit 38: CMP338 Analytic Architecture Design (15 UK Credits)

  13. Unit 39: CMP339 Network Management (15 UK Credits)

  14. Unit 40: CMP340 Client/Server Computing Systems (15 UK Credits)

  15. Unit 41: CMP341 Database Management Systems (15 UK Credits)

  16. Unit 42: CMP342 Game Design Theory (15 UK Credits)

  17. Unit 43: CMP343 Games Development (15 UK Credits)

  18. Unit 44: CMP344 Games Engine & Scripting (15 UK Credits)

  19. Unit 45: CMP345 Internet of Things (15 UK Credits)

  20. Unit 46: CMP346 Robotics (15 UK Credits)

  21. Unit 47: CMP347 Emerging Technologies (15 UK Credits)

  22. Unit 48: CMP348 Virtual & Augmented Reality Development (15 UK Credits)

  23. Unit 49: CMP349 Systems Integration (15 UK Credits)

  24. Unit 50: CMP350 Operating Systems (15 UK Credits)

  25. Unit 51: CMP351 E-Commerce & Strategy (15 UK Credits)

  26. Unit 52: CMP352 Digital Sustainability (15 UK Credits)

  27. Unit 53: CMP353 Digital Technology as a Catalyst for Change (15 UK Credits)

  28. Unit 54: CMP354 Prototyping (15 UK Credits)

​

+ General Education Subjects

Year 4 - UK Level 6 (Top-Up)
   2 Core Mandatory Subjects
+ 3 Mandatory Specialist Subjects

+   General Education Subjects

YEAR 4 - UK Level 6 (Top-Up)

​

Core Mandatory Subjects/Units

  1. Unit 1: CMP401/ CIS3004-N Computing Project (Part 1 & Part 2) (40 UK Credits)

  2. Unit 2: CMP402/ CIS3011-N Internet of Things (20 UK Credits)        

 

+ 3 Mandatory Specialist Subjects/Units

  1. Unit 6: CMP406/ CIS3014-N Software Reliability (20 UK Credits)  

  2. Unit 7 CMP407/ CIS3003-N Cloud System DevOps (20 UK Credits)                 

  3. Unit 8: CMP408/ CIS3002-N Knowledge Based AI (20 UK Credits)  

​

+ General Education Subjects

bottom of page